New York City has begun accepting applications for the summer youth employment lottery.
The program gives summer jobs to teens in places such as police precincts, hospitals and retail stores.
Competition for the positions is stiff. Last year, more than 50,000 Brooklyn teens applied for positions. This year, there are only about 9,000 positions available.
Teens have until May 18 to apply before the lottery starts.
